Scanning Electron Microscope Studies of Apices of Lilium longiflorum for Determining Floral Initiation and Differentiation1,2

Abstract
Intact stem apices of Lilium longiflorum Thunb. cv. ‘Ace’ were prepared for scanning electron microscopy to determine floral initiation and differentiation by viewing topographical changes. The apices, after removal of leaves under running water, were frozen in liquid N2, freeze-dried on carbon discs and coated with carbon prior to viewing. Electron photomicrographs were taken of vegetative, transitional and reproductive apices. This method of tissue preparation permitted microscopic evidence of flower bud initiation and differentiation to be obtained in less than 9 hr after removal of the apex from the plant. The apices retained their in vivo configuration, but as dry, permanent, 3-dimensional mounts. Cell net studies of the apical meristem are possible with this technique. This method of preparation is also adaptable to light microscopy.
